Overview: Renewable energy investments could play an important (and multidimensional) role within a long-term investor's broader investment strategy. Generally, they will be viewed as an absolute return investment, and due to their high specific risks, they will probably have a relatively small allocation within a diversified portfolio. Given the secular trends in place, the idiosyncratic nature of investments and the type of funds available, we expect a low correlation with other assets. Hence, these funds may offer diversification benefits by lowering the overall risk within investment portfolios. For beneficiaries that prize responsible investment, renewable energy is also likely to be appealing.
